They come in several different sizes. I looked back at last years order and they were 42mm and that covered all the festoons. Most if not all the festoon bulbs will be for ceiling lights but I also used the 42mm festoon on the red and green nav lights too. Pull one out and check. You never know what size bulb Bayliner used that day.
